I_CPROJECT
CProject Higher Level Nodes
I_CPROJECT is a CDS View in S/4HANA. CProject Higher Level Nodes. It contains 5 fields. 2 CDS views read from this table.
CDS Views using this table (2)
| View | Type | Join | VDM | Description |
|---|---|---|---|---|
| I_CProjectItem | view | from | BASIC | CProject Item |
| P_Cproject | view | from | COMPOSITE | CPROJECT |
Fields (5)
| Key | Field | CDS Fields | Used in Views |
|---|---|---|---|
| _MasterProject | _MasterProject | 1 | |
| MasterProjectItem | MasterProjectItem | 2 | |
| MasterProjectItemObjectType | MasterProjectItemObjectType | 2 | |
| MasterProjectUUID | MasterProjectUUID | 2 | |
| ProjectExternalID | ProjectExternalID | 1 |
@AbapCatalog.sqlViewName: 'ICPROJECT'
@ClientHandling.algorithm: #SESSION_VARIABLE
@AbapCatalog.compiler.compareFilter: true
@ObjectModel.usageType.dataClass: #TRANSACTIONAL
@ObjectModel.usageType.serviceQuality: #A
@ObjectModel.usageType.sizeCategory: #XL
@AccessControl.authorizationCheck: #CHECK
@EndUserText.label: 'CProject Higher Level Nodes'
@VDM.viewType: #BASIC
define view I_CProject
as select from I_MasterProjectItem as MasterProjectItem
inner join iaom_ext_obj_inf as ExternalObjInfo on ExternalObjInfo.ext_object_id = MasterProjectItem.MasterProjectItem
association [1..1] to I_MasterProject as _MasterProject on $projection.MasterProjectUUID = _MasterProject.MasterProjectUUID
{
ExternalObjInfo.ext_object_id as ProjectExternalID,
ExternalObjInfo.acc_ass_object as ExternalObjectIdentifier,
ExternalObjInfo.business_key as Project,
MasterProjectItem.MasterProjectUUID,
MasterProjectItem.MasterProjectItemUUID,
MasterProjectItem.MasterProjectItem,
MasterProjectItem.MasterProjectItemObjectType,
_MasterProject
}
where
ExternalObjInfo.bus_scenario_id = 'CPROJECTS'